Produced with Care Across Three Origins, Roasted in Berkeley, California
This espresso blend draws from three distinct growing communities — each chosen for what it contributes to the cup. Oaxacan smallholders bring structure and dark chocolate depth. Huehuetenango's high-altitude cooperative farms add body and a bright citrus backbone. And from Yirgacheffe — widely considered the birthplace of coffee — heirloom varieties grown in forest shade deliver the floral lift and stone fruit sweetness that pull the blend together. All three origins are organically certified, smallholder-farmed, and washed process. The result is an espresso with layered complexity and a clean finish — built for the shot, but forgiving enough for milk.

Humble roots from our San Francisco apartment
Sonreír began our San Francisco apartment, selling freshly roasted coffee to freinds and family, fueled by a love for great coffee and a desire to share it. What started as home roasting quickly evolved into a deeper commitment—to sourcing with intention, supporting smallholder farmers, and perfecting every batch.
From those early roasts at home to our small-batch production in Berkeley, our mission remains the same—creating coffee that connects, inspires, and brings a little more joy to every cup.
Small Batch Coffee Fresh-Roasted
At Sonreír, we believe great coffee is a journey and embrace the spirit of continuous improvement. Always refining our roasting process to bring out the best in every bean.
We roast small batches on our 5kg Probat gas roaster in Berkeley, CA. This hands-on approach ensures every cup delivers the vibrant flavors and joyful experience we strive for.
